Inter American University of Puerto Rico-Guayama vs. Universidad Pentecostal Mizpa

Both Inter American University of Puerto Rico-Guayama and Universidad Pentecostal Mizpa are Private, 4 years schools located in Puerto Rico. The following statements compare Inter American University of Puerto Rico-Guayama and Universidad Pentecostal Mizpa with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• Inter American University of Puerto Rico-Guayama's tuition ($5,580) is more expensive than Universidad Pentecostal Mizpa ($4,220).

  • Universidad Pentecostal Mizpa's students to faculty ratio (12 to 1) is lower than Inter American University of Puerto Rico-Guayama (22 to 1).
  • Inter American University of Puerto Rico-Guayama (1,605 students) is larger than Universidad Pentecostal Mizpa (152 students) with more enrolled students.
  • Inter American University of Puerto Rico-Guayama ($7,261) has higher amount of financial aid than Universidad Pentecostal Mizpa ($2,221).
  • Inter American University of Puerto Rico-Guayama's graduation rate (40%) is higher than Universidad Pentecostal Mizpa (5%).
